In the expression 5³, what is the base?

In the expression 5³, the base refers to the number that is being multiplied by itself. The notation indicates that 5 is raised to the power of 3, which means 5 is used as a factor three times in multiplication: 5 × 5 × 5. Therefore, the base of the expression 5³ is 5. This is a foundational concept in exponentiation where the base denotes the number being exponentiated.
